What they do
A Judge oversees the legal process in court cases. Interprets law, advises jurors during trials, writes opinions and decisions, and gives verdicts in cases decided without a jury. May decide on a sentence for the defendant in a criminal case, or liability of a defendant in a civil case; may facilitate negotiations between parties in a dispute. Works in a county, state or federal court system.

RICHMOND COUNTY DISTRICT ATTORNEY
The men and women of the Richmond County District Attorney's office work each day in partnership with Law Enforcement and the people of Staten Island to pursue justice for victims of crime, to prevent crime in all its forms, and to promote the safety and wellbeing of all citizens of our Borough.THE ROLE
The Richmond County District Attorney's Office is seeking admitted attorneys, law graduates who have passed the New York State Bar and are awaiting admission, or who are approaching their last year of law school and preparing to take the New York State Bar Examination to perform prosecutorial duties in our Criminal Court Bureau. Under the general supervision of the Chief of Criminal Court Bureau, the selected candidates' specific duties will include:- Screening new arrests and drafting accusatory instruments in the RCDA complaint room.
- Prosecuting misdemeanor cases that include, but are not limited to: DWI, assault, drug offenses, petit larceny, weapons possession, criminal mischief, VTL offenses, etc.
- Representing the District Attorney at arraignments, calendar calls, misdemeanor hearings, and trials.
- Participate in ongoing training in criminal law, criminal procedure, and trial advocacy and skills.
